If your MOZA setup isn’t working correctly in Forza Horizon 6, here’s a quick guide that should help resolve the most common issues:
1. Game Installation
It can be installed via official channels such as Steam. If you have performed a custom installation, you will need to specify the directory for Forza Horizon 6 in the Pit House game list.
2.Force Feedback Settings
All the MOZA Racing Wheelbases support Force Feedback.
3. Telemetry Configuration
After entering the game, click ‘Settings’.

After entering the settings, click on ‘HUD & Gameplay’, turn to the bottom.

Once you have completed the above steps, you will be able to obtain telemetry data via the steering wheel speed indicator and the instrument panel.
4. Device Control Mapping
You will need to configure the control mapping when you launch the game for the first time.

To enter the game, first click on 【Settings】to enter the Settings page.
After entering the Settings page, click on 【Controls】, and Select 【Change Input Mapping】

Note: Buttons displaying a yellow exclamation mark in the game interface UI must be bound; control presets will only be maintained once binding is complete.

Why is there no force feedback in Forza Horizon 6? Other games work fine.
If there is no force feedback when using the MOZA Base in “Forza Horizon 6”, you can troubleshoot in the following way:
1.Firstly, keep the steering wheelbase connected to the computer
Please disconnect the handbrake, shifter, pedals, third-party steering wheel and other peripherals first, leaving the MOZA base for the first binding.
2.Set the preferred device in Windows
Open the Windows Game Controller Settings, set MOZA Base as the preferred device, and then re-enter the game to bind the steering wheel.
3.Confirm that the MOZA Base in the game is “Device 1”
The Horizon series typically outputs force feedback to “Device 1”, and it is necessary to confirm the binding in the game control.

4.After completing the Base binding, connect the other devices one by one.
The suggested sequence is: first, binding the base → confirm the force feedback → then connect the handbrake/shifter and other accessories → rebind one by one.
